What You Will Do

As Environmental Health & Safety (EH&S) Specialist, you’ll support Pratt & Whitney's EH&S team's ongoing compliance and risk reduction efforts at the Clayville, NY site.  This complex manufacturing site offers an opportunity to work with manufacturing and support teams to foster employee engagement and drive risk reduction and continuous improvement of the EH&S program. 

Key responsibilities will include:

  • Taking proactive steps to ensure the safety and health of site employees and influencing safe behaviors; recognizing, evaluating and controlling hazardous workplace conditions

  • Working with subject matter experts to assure compliance with applicable federal, state, local and company EHS requirements; executing initiatives, programs, reports and trainings across multiple EH&S disciplines to achieve and maintain compliance.

  • Auditing and evaluating current policies, procedures and documentation to assure compliance with applicable laws and regulations

  • Investigating, analyzing and interpreting data from injuries and near-misses ensuring corrective actions are completed on time, and all necessary documentation is in place

  • Prepares and manages documentation relating to environmental, health & safety policies in preparation for audit; provides proper documentation in preparation for permits and liaising with governmental bodies.

  • Oversees programs related to waste, water, air management, hazardous waste and environmental remediation.

  • Develops and advises employee workplace programs related to emergency response, workers compensation, ergonomics and industrial hygiene.

  • Maintains EH&S Management System Conformance.

  • Achieves and maintains consistency of EH&S record keeping and documentation with organizational and regulatory policy.

  • Collaborates across departments to achieve and maintain consistency of EH&S program implementation.

  • Position requires limited travel for participation in Company seminars, EHS audits and training opportunities.

Qualifications You Must Have

  • Bachelor's degree and 5 or more years' experience working in environmental health and safety OR a Master's degree and 3 or more years of relevant experience.

  • Experience with Microsoft Office products (Word, Excel, Outlook, etc.).

  • Experience working with OSHA, Federal and State environmental regulations in an aerospace manufacturing facility.

Qualifications We Prefer

  • Degree in Safety, Environmental, Engineering, Environmental Science, or related field of study

  • Experience managing EH&S issues in a manufacturing environment with constantly shifting priorities

  • Experience working at an OSHA VPP (Voluntary Protection Program) site

  • Demonstrated experience organizing and managing multiple projects and programs in a rapidly fluctuating environment

  • Professional Certification in the EH&S field (ASP, CSP, CIH, etc.)
